This second volume of Queen Victoria’s selected correspondence covers the years 1844 to 1853, spanning some of the most eventful years of her early reign. The letters touch on major political events, the health and death of Prince Albert’s relatives, the Revolutions of 1848 across Europe, and the intimate workings of court and government as filtered through Victoria’s own frank voice.
